P-Shot in Riyadh: Safety, Side Effects, and Recovery
The P-Shot in riyadh, or Priapus Shot, is gaining popularity in Riyadh as a non-surgical treatment for erectile dysfunction and for penile enhancement. It utilizes platelet-rich plasma (PRP) derived from the patient's own blood, which is injected into the penis to stimulate tissue regeneration and improve blood flow. While generally considered safe due to the autologous nature of the treatment, it's essential to understand the potential safety aspects, side effects, and the expected recovery process.
Safety Profile of the P-Shot
The P-Shot is often touted as a safe procedure because it uses the patient's own blood, significantly reducing the risk of allergic reactions or immune responses. However, like any medical procedure involving injections, certain safety considerations must be taken into account:
- Sterile Environment: The procedure must be performed in a sterile clinical environment by qualified medical professionals to minimize the risk of infection. Reputable clinics in Riyadh should adhere to strict hygiene protocols.
- Experienced Practitioners: The skill and experience of the practitioner administering the P-Shot are crucial for safety and optimal outcomes. Ensure the clinic has doctors trained in PRP therapy and the specific P-Shot technique.
- Patient Selection: Not all individuals are suitable candidates for the P-Shot. Those with active infections, bleeding disorders, or certain other medical conditions may be advised against it. A thorough medical history review during the initial consultation is vital.
- Proper Technique: Correct injection techniques are necessary to avoid damage to nerves, blood vessels, or other penile structures.
Potential Side Effects
While the P-Shot is generally well-tolerated, some mild and temporary side effects can occur at the injection sites:
- Pain and Discomfort: Some men may experience mild to moderate pain or soreness immediately after the injections. This usually subsides within a few hours to a few days and can often be managed with over-the-counter pain relievers like acetaminophen.
- Swelling: Mild swelling at the injection sites is common and typically resolves within a few days. Applying ice packs wrapped in a cloth can help reduce swelling.
- Bruising: Bruising may occur at the injection sites due to the needle insertion. This is usually minor and fades within a week or two. Arnica gel can sometimes help reduce bruising.
- Redness: Some redness or flushing of the treated area may be observed immediately after the procedure, which usually resolves within a few hours.
- Temporary Numbness or Tingling: Some patients might experience temporary changes in sensation, such as numbness or tingling, which typically resolves within a day or two.
Rare but Potential Risks: Although uncommon, more serious complications could include infection, hematoma (collection of blood under the skin), or, very rarely, priapism (prolonged erection). Choosing a reputable clinic with experienced practitioners and adhering to post-procedure instructions can significantly minimize these risks.
Recovery Process
The recovery period after the P-Shot in Riyadh is generally short, with most men able to resume their normal activities relatively quickly:
- Immediate Post-Procedure: You can typically go home shortly after the procedure. Some clinics advise against strenuous physical activity for the first 24-48 hours. Wearing loose-fitting clothing is recommended for comfort.
- Sexual Activity: Most practitioners advise abstaining from sexual intercourse or masturbation for 24-72 hours to allow the injection sites to heal and to minimize the risk of complications.
- Pain Management: Mild discomfort can usually be managed with over-the-counter pain relievers as needed. Avoid non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) like ibuprofen for a few days as they might interfere with the PRP's healing effects.
- Hygiene: Keep the treated area clean and dry. Follow any specific instructions provided by your clinic regarding showering or cleansing.
- Hydration: Staying well-hydrated is important for overall healing.
- Follow-Up: Attend any scheduled follow-up appointments with your doctor to monitor your progress and address any concerns.
- Timeline for Results: While some men may notice initial effects within days or weeks due to increased blood flow, the full benefits of the P-Shot, which involve tissue regeneration, may take several weeks to a few months to become apparent.
It's crucial to follow the specific post-procedure instructions provided by your chosen clinic in Riyadh to ensure proper healing and maximize the potential benefits of the P-Shot. If you experience any signs of infection (increased redness, swelling, pain, fever, discharge) or any other concerning symptoms, contact your doctor immediately.
